Output dc60c13063b875f4fc17563108542ca754790ed2da1850ea2954e323315d089a:1

value
129054824
script pubkey
OP_0 OP_PUSHBYTES_32 0ea5fbadd9c010bc54d7a0384393649ffc32d7e3b0f49c59b04f1d8d28ef7971
address
bc1qp6jlhtwecqgtc4xh5quy8ymynl7r94lrkr6fckdsfuwc628009cs7hpdlg
transaction
dc60c13063b875f4fc17563108542ca754790ed2da1850ea2954e323315d089a
spent
true